Onboarding: Syncbridge calendar conflicts. When Pellwick Scheduler and the Torvane client disagree on event ownership, the reconciler in `calsync/merge.go` picks the newer etag. Reviewers: reject any PR that bypasses the conflict ledger — silent overwrites caused the Q3 incident at the Marlow office. Test fixtures live in `fixtures/conflict_pairs`. If the reconciler deadlocks, restart the worker pool with the admin flag; the console will prompt for the recovery passphrase before unlocking the ledger. Use the phrase below to proceed.

strongbox words: fraath-isteth

Ticket: Staging env misconfigured for Siftgate bloom filter

The bloom layer in front of the Pellet KV store is rejecting all lookups in staging because the env file was copied from the dev template without credentials. False-positive tuning values are fine; only the auth line is missing. To unblock the weekly demo, the Pellet admission secret must be set on the following line.

env line for yaguf-fajop: LEDGER_TOKEN13=fb08984397349

**Mgmt Meeting Minutes — Retiring the Brightline Range**

Quick recap for sales leads at Fenholt Supplies: we agreed to retire the Brightline fixture range by year-end. Remaining stock moves to clearance pricing next month, and accounts on standing orders get migrated to the Lumetta range. Trade-in incentives were approved in principle. The confidential note on next steps sits just below.

board note of bajof-bajeg: The pricing group signed off on a budget of $13.4 million for Project Sildor. The renewal with Lamixek Holdings closes at $48.9 million a year, 49 percent above the last contract.

## Changelog — Font vendoring defaults changed

As of this release, the Bracken UI build no longer fetches third-party fonts at build time. All typefaces used by the Lanternwell suite are now vendored into the repo under a dedicated assets directory, and the fetch step is skipped by default. If you're onboarding, nothing to install — the fonts travel with the checkout. The build flags controlling this behavior are listed below.

settings of hadup-yafog:
LAMAEL_PIN=3761
LAMAEL_TENANT=istmir
LAMAEL_METRICS_HOST=metrics.lamael.plorvasys.test
LAMAEL_SEAL=seal_8ea68500
LAMAEL_STANDBY_TEAM=fraok